Parameswara was never a muslim!

Filed under: interesting stuff — nesh @ 2:39 pm

I received a sms yesterday saying that Parameswara never embraced Islam during his lifetime.He lived and died as a Hindu according to Malacca International Islamic College of Technology president Prof Emeritus Datuk Mohd Yusoff Hashim.He also says that it was Parameswara’s son Megat Iskandar Shah who actually became Islam.There was an article about Malacca’s history on nst and parameswara’s religion issue was just a small portion of it but by far the most significant one in my opinion.Try checking on the article by going to nst online.You might be interested to know more.
